This Date in Weather History

1987 - The western U.S. continued to sizzle. Afternoon highs of 85 degrees at Astoria OR, 101 degrees at Tucson AZ, and 102 degrees at Sacramento CA, equalled October records. It marked the fourth time in the month that Sacramento tied their record for October.

About Bushwood, Maryland

Bushwood is an unincorporated community in what is familiarly called the "Seventh District" of St. Mary's County, Maryland, United States. Ocean Hall was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1973. The ZIP Code for Bushwood is 20618.
